South High School’s International Students Association Presents $565 For Low Income Families In Pakistan

WHO: Officers and members of the South High School International Students Association (ISA), a group of 45 students from approximately 20 countries.

WHAT: Will present checks totaling $565.00 from their fundraising efforts to The School House Project.

WHEN: Thursday, February 28, 10:40 a.m.

WHERE: Room 124, South High School, 1700 E. Louisiana Ave.

WHY: The School House Project is providing support for Alimtiaz Academy, a non-religious school for children of low-income families in Abbottabad, Pakistan. Donations will help fund scholarships ($90.00 covers a full year's tuition), books, and computers.

HOW: ISA members made posters, created a display, manned a collection, table, visited classrooms, and donated their profits from after-school pizza sales.
